TEHRAN: Iranian police said they had closed more than 800 clothes shops to stop them selling "unconventional" women’s coats, state media reported on Monday.

A further 3,000 shops have been sent warnings, the IRNA news agency reported.

A new fashion for women’s coats -- k**wn as "manteaux" in Iran -- with English phrases printed on the back had attracted the attention of the authorities, who passed new regulations in July.

The coats in question tend to have **nsensical phrases such as "Keep Calm I’m the Queen" written on them, but they also have short arms and ** buttons in the front.

Under Iranian law, women must wear a manteau, or similar item, that loosely covers the whole body from the neck down to the knee.
